Step-by-step explanation:
Given that ducation of the self-employed: according to a recent current population reports, the population distribution of number of years of education for self-employed individuals in the united states has a mean of 13.6 and a standard deviation of 3.0.
The central limit theorem says sample mean follows normal for randomly drawn samples of large sizes.
a) Hence X bar follows a normal with mean = 13.6
and std dev = std dev of sample/square root of sample size.
Hence std dev of x bar = 3/sqrt 100 = 0.3
b) when n =400 square root of n becomes double making the std dev of sample mean exactly 1/2
Hence new std dev = 3/sqrt 400 = 0.15
Whenever n increases we get std deviation of sample mean decreases.

Answer:
6032 gallons
Step-by-step explanation:
The diameter of the cylindrical swimming pool is 16 ft
The height(h) of the pool is 4 ft
Volume of a cylinder is given by;
Volume (v) = π × r² × h
Radius (r) = 16/2 ft = 8 ft
v = π × (8 ft)² × 4ft = 804.247719319ft³
Given; 1ft³ = 7.5 gallons (gal)
804.247719319ft³ would equal to how many gallons?
Cross multiplying gives,
× 7.5 gal = 6031.85789489
Which equals to 6032 gallons rounded up to whole number.
